LAGUNA, Philippines – Payback.
The National Capital Region (NCR) gets its sweet revenge after beating its 2013 Palaro basketball tormentor Central Visayas, 90-80 to enter the finals of the 57th edition of the country's biggest sporting event.
READ: Calabarzon, NCR survive foes to arrange grand HS hoops finale
NCR took an early lead after the first quarter, 20-12 and never looked back. The 2013 silver medalists led by as much as 12, 73-61 in the 4th quarter.
Defending champions Central Visayas threatened to comeback cutting the deficit to 5, 85-80 with 34.7 ticks left. Unfortunately they didn't have enough left in the tank to complete a comeback.
